November 6, sunny weather, winds from the northwest.
After several days of preparation, everyone finally set sail on the Berio from Fenris. As the ship passed through the Overseas, through the clouds, everyone saw a new Great Rift Valley stretching from the east to the west—it spanned the bay, marking the most conspicuous scar Leon on the island from the disaster.
Perhaps for a long time to come, people will remember this terrible disaster.

November 10, clear skies, North Wind.
Four days after leaving Fenris, the Berio reached the waters off Colin, where the sailors also spotted some near-shore birds; that ancient continent may now be not too far from us.
This voyage was much calmer than the last, the great storms had passed, and the Cloud Sea in the last days of autumn repeated its tranquility and peace. As for the pirates mentioned by the sailors, they never appeared, as if they were just a noun from a distant story.
However, the days at sea are not boring, each day filled with strange and splendid scenery.

After writing the last word, Fang Hong put down the quill pen and gently closed the journal.
He lifted his head, staring unmoving at a shaft of sunlight that was streaming through the latticed porthole and falling on the swaying deck, while the desk lamp and the ceiling's iron cage swayed along, creaking softly and rhythmically.
But he had gradually grown accustomed to this rhythm, as well as the intoxicating scent of Ether mixed with the sea breeze. Since leaving Fenris, Fang Hong had started learning to write a sailing journal, which did not take up much time, but was filled with fun.
He rested for a while before opening a drawer and picking out a golden ring from between a pile of coins and several books, lifting it up to examine closely.
The ring was cool to the touch, with a heavy weight as if crafted from rough gold, its surface sporting some uneven textures, reflecting the sunlight, shimmering in the dark.
But it had once been much brighter than it was now.
When Fang Hong first saw the ring in Dolifen, it glowed like Golden Flame flowing in magma, like a luminous gemstone, constantly radiating intense heat and brilliance.
When it appeared again in the underground of the Black Holy City, it was like a newborn sun, with light and heat erupting continuously, dispelling all darkness and fog.
But not like it is now.
However, in his system, the description above the ring's phantom remained unchanged:
'A powerful Strength is contained within—'
In truth, Fang Hong knew that this ring contained a powerful Strength—he had absorbed the entire Strength of the Shadow of Nicopolis in Dolifen, and this time it had devoured a manifestation of Toragotos.
Even more outrageous, it had also taken in a part of Salrutaka's Strength, and after a Deity's Strength entered the ring, it completely changed its appearance.
It no longer shone as before, appearing to fall into a silence, turning into its current unremarkable appearance.
And the three powerful forces, since entering the ring, had also shown no response, as if the object were a bottomless pit, or perhaps its interior led to Subspace. The only slight change might be that Fang Hong faintly sensed a connection forming between it and himself.
In these days, this was not the first time he scrutinized the ring so carefully.
But equally, when he picked up the ring, in the quiet space, he felt that unique sensation again.
The feeling was indescribable, as if a thought was emerging in his mind, but it was not his own idea. Rather, it felt like a strange will wishing to communicate with him on a cognitive level.
But this thought was not stable. It only appeared for a moment when he calmed down and was slightly lost in thought, and as soon as he snapped back to reality, it would vanish without a trace.
He once thought it was an illusion.
But Miss Fairy's words not long ago dispelled this belief; she told him that indeed a new 'Mark' had appeared in his Spirit World.
"A new 'Mark'?"
"Or to put it more commonly, a contract," Miss Tata had replied at the time.
"A contract?"
"Just like the contract between Mr. Knight and me—"
So Fang Hong started to feel uneasy.
His contract with Miss Tata, naturally, was the Dragon Soul contract, and a new contract similar to it had appeared in his Spirit World, which meant a new Dragon Soul was being born—and its origin was crystal clear to him.
That could very likely be a Dark Dragon Soul.
But he had never heard of such a thing. Could Dark Dragons also leave behind Dragon Souls? And how could a person form connections with two Dragon Souls?
However, regarding this question,
Miss Fairy could only look calmly, making eye contact with him.
Because historically, no one had ever signed two Dragon Soul contracts.
And no one had ever forged such a ring with the Golden Star Pupil, let alone used the Ring of Golden Flame to absorb a part of the Strength of two Dark Giant Dragons and a Dark Deity, therefore no one could tell them.
What exactly had happened inside this ring,
And more importantly, whether this change was good or bad—Fang Hong did not know.
Day after day passed, and he indeed felt more clearly the growth of the gestating Dragon Soul. There seemed to be a barrier between it and his Spirit World, and it kept knocking against that membrane.
